The best Side of roboslot
Sampling-centered search algorithms, which make a searchable tree by randomly sampling new nodes or robot configurations inside a point out House. Sampling-primarily based algorithms can be well suited for high-dimensional look for spaces like All those used to locate a legitimate list of configurations for your robot arm to choose up an object.Design kinematics and dynamics of cellular robots and manipulators. Use a library of generally made use of robots, or import URDF data files or Simscape Multibody designs to generate custom made robot versions. Visualize and simulate robot movement to validate your algorithms.
Matters On this study course will also be available as self-paced online coaching involved together with your Online Teaching Suite membership.
Each individual joint angle is calculated from your pose of the top-effector based on a mathematical formula. By defining the joint parameters and finish-effector poses symbolically, IK can discover all doable methods from the joint angles within an analytic form to be a function of your lengths on the linkages, its starting off posture, and the rotation constraints.
SLAM algorithms are beneficial in a number of other purposes for example navigating a fleet of cell robots to rearrange cabinets in a very warehouse, parking a self-driving automobile in an empty spot, or providing a offer by navigating a drone within an mysterious environment.
Select a Website to get translated articles where out there and see nearby activities and offers. Based on your locale, we advise that you choose: .
Computing Expense is a challenge when applying SLAM algorithms get more info on car hardware. Computation is frequently executed on compact and reduced-Electrical read more power embedded microprocessors which have limited processing power. To accomplish correct localization, it is vital to execute picture processing and position cloud matching at significant frequency.
Opt for a web site to acquire translated content material exactly where out there and find out nearby events and provides. Based on your locale, we advocate that read more you select: .
Pose graphs are produced to help proper the mistakes. By fixing error minimization being an optimization difficulty, far more exact map details could be generated. This type of optimization is known as bundle adjustment in Visible SLAM.
There are lots of approaches for using a motion model with sensor fusion. A common process is utilizing Kalman filtering for localization. Because most differential travel robots and 4-wheeled autos usually use nonlinear movement products, extended Kalman filters and particle filters (Monte Carlo localization) in many cases are used.
Perspective, plot, and log personalized message contents specifically in MATLAB. Use ROS specialised messages to produce and entry sensor and facts styles making use of distinct ROS and ROS 2 information forms.
Make use of the trapezoidal velocity profile to design a trajectory with input bounds in place website of parameters.
“Product-Based Design and style and computerized check here code era enable us to manage Along with the complexity of Agile Justin’s 53 degrees of liberty. Without the need of Model-Dependent Layout it would've been impossible to build the controllers for this sort of a posh robotic technique with challenging serious-time functionality.”
The greedy stop of the robot arm is designated as the tip-effector. The robot configuration is a list of joint positions that are inside the place limitations with the robot model and don't violate any constraints the robot has.
Generating dynamically feasible paths for several sensible purposes make sampling-based organizing well known, Though it does not deliver an entire solution.